Inter Milan are interested in signing Erik Lamela this summer, according to Sky Sports.

If that deal happens, Sky speculate that Tottenham could move for AC Milan playmaker Suso as a replacement.

Lamela has been out of action with a hip injury since last October and is expected to be sidelined until this October, at which point he will have been out for an entire year.

The Argentine has joined his teammates for pre-season training but will mainly be doing rehabilitation work in a bid to keep his return on schedule.

Inter Milan could swoop for Lamela before the transfer deadline regardless of his injury problems.

Spurs could look at former Liverpool midfielder Suso to fill the gap that will potentially be left by Lamela. The Spaniard has been repeatedly linked with a move back to England.

Suso has just two years left on his contract with Milan, so Tottenham might be able to sign him for a relatively small fee.
